FIRES.
A BLAZE AT NAPIER
[PEE PRESS ASSOCIATION.'!
NAPIER,, Jan. 21
There wore all the elements of a big blaze in the centre of the town last night, a fire starting in the Plumbing Company's premises, near the City Buffet, in Emerson Street. The delay in giving the alarm at the fire .station was responsible for the 1 ite appearance- of the brigade .and the structure was a mass of flames when the water was turned on. By splendid work, however, the brigade soon got the upper hand. The workshop was spitted. The insurance on the building is £l5O in the Norwich Union office, and on the contents £l2O in the- North British office.
